Understanding Fat Loss
Before we dive into specific strategies, it’s essential to understand the basics of fat loss. When you consume more calories than your body needs, the excess calories are stored as fat. It would be best if you created a calorie deficit to burn fat calories by consuming fewer calories than your body burns. This forces your body to tap into its fat stores for energy, leading to fat loss.
Setting Realistic Goals
Setting realistic and achievable goals is one of the most critical factors in burning fat calories fast. Instead of aiming for drastic weight loss overnight, focus on gradual progress. Aim to lose 1-2 pounds per week, which is considered a safe and sustainable rate of weight loss. Setting achievable goals will keep you motivated and make it easier to stay on track.

The Importance of Hydration
Staying hydrated is essential for fat loss. Water is vital in numerous bodily functions, including metabolism and fat burning. Aim to drink at least 8-10 glasses of water daily to stay hydrated and support your fat loss efforts. Additionally, opt for water instead of sugary beverages, as they can add unnecessary calories to your diet.

Effective Workouts for Fat Loss
In addition to following a healthy diet, incorporating regular exercise into your routine is crucial in burning fat calories fast. Focus on a combination of cardiovascular exercise, strength training, and high-intensity interval training (HIIT) for optimal fat loss results. Cardiovascular exercises such as running, cycling, and swimming help burn calories, while strength training helps build lean muscle mass and boost metabolism. HIIT workouts are effective for burning fat and increasing overall fitness levels.

Importance of Sleep and Recovery
Getting an adequate amount of sleep is crucial for fat loss and overall health. Lack of sleep can disrupt your hormones and metabolism, making it harder to burn fat calories.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ep per night to support your fat loss efforts. Additionally, prioritize rest days and active recovery to prevent burnout and allow your body to recover from intense workouts.

Supplementing for Fat Loss
While proper nutrition and exercise are the foundation of fat loss, certain supplements can help accelerate the process. Some popular fat-burning supplements include caffeine, green tea extract, and conjugated linoleic acid (CLA). However, consulting a healthcare professional before taking supplements is essential, as they may only suit some.
